Switches build-examples to the new base command that handles the boilerplate of looping over target packages. While modifying the command, also does some minor cleanup: - Extracts a helper to reduce duplicated details of calling `flutter build` - Switches the flag for iOS to `--ios` rather than `--ipa` since `ios` is what is actually passed to the build command - iOS no longer defaults to on, so that it behaves like all the other platform flags - Passing no platform flags is now an error rather than a silent pass, to ensure that we never accidentally have CI doing a no-op run without noticing. - Rewords the logging slightly for the versions where the label for what is being built is a platform, not an artifact (which is now everything but Android). Part of flutter/flutter#83413
